> Кстати, те, кто был в Праге в прошлом году, могли наблюдать интеграцию > Lucene и Fyracle на моей презентации по Java Stored Procedures. Это > конечно был только пример (где-то 200 строчек кода, может меньше), но > вполне рабочий. Идея работы там такая же как и в PostgreSQL FTS от > которой Дима Кузьменко тащится.
Почитал вот этот документ http://www.sai.msu.su/~megera/postgres/talks/fts_pgsql_intro.html В частности интересовала структура индекса GIN http://www.sai.msu.su/~megera/postgres/talks/fts_pgsql_intro.html#ftsindex Получается, что комбинации лексем (в целях оптимизации поиска) они не хранят. Поэтому чтобы получить данные, в которые входят несколько лексем, нужно построить пересечение. Неужто в PG так здорово работают join-ы на больших объемах? Если судить по восторгам о том как там все здорово сделано? Коваленко Дмитрий.

